It was on Incursion (you need the longer map time), I was using Orendi with a 0 cost shard, 0 cost wrench, and a -cooldown with -cooldown while skills are on cooldown. I also used the ult cooldown on the helix.
Be a shard whore and build, build, build and wave clear. Youāll be at level 5 by the time most people are just hitting 3. Then play overly aggressive and hunt down those kills. But as mentioned, the crowd thatās left wonāt make it easy by a long shot. The only plus to her ult outside of the huge damage is itās got huge range and usually, if timed right, can nab you 2 kills, sometimes 3 if the team is playing tight.
